Transaction 74bf568966a830c9ccb491754176c0417afc551677efa024c5650cbae04f74e0
1 Input
1 Output
-
74bf568966a830c9ccb491754176c0417afc551677efa024c5650cbae04f74e0:0
- value
- 485100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 039a5049dd8b0e49144d84db074c90ca537f719b OP_EQUAL
- address
- 3224p1ztDA8eveanboE4tMCPzVwQhZeaKn